Overview of the Payroll Specialist Role:
The Payroll Specialist will play an important role in ensuring accurate and timely payroll processing while supporting employees and maintaining compliance with payroll regulations.
Responsibilities include:
- Process payroll for employees on a scheduled basis, including weekly, bi-weekly, and/or monthly payroll cycles
- Ensure accurate calculation of wages, overtime, bonuses, deductions, benefits, and taxes
- Maintain and update payroll records, including employee information, tax forms, and direct deposit details
- Review and verify timekeeping records and resolve discrepancies
- Respond to employee payroll-related questions and provide timely support
- Ensure compliance with federal, state, and local payroll laws and regulations
- Prepare payroll reports for management, finance, and auditing purposes
- Partner closely with HR and finance to ensure smooth and accurate payroll operations
- Process and file payroll tax reports, W-2s, and other required payroll documentation
- Manage garnishments, deductions, benefit contributions, and other payroll adjustments
- Assist with payroll audits and reporting requirements
- Stay current on payroll regulations, compliance requirements, and industry best practices
Preferred Qualifications:
- 2+ years of payroll processing experience required
- Strong knowledge of payroll taxes, deductions, garnishments, and compliance requirements
- Experience working with payroll systems and timekeeping platforms
